    Agree with kermit...he was better before roy jones. That being said a lot of positives to take away tonight for him.

    But he,d have battered williams with his old style. He,ll never have the accuracy to be a great boxer or a pot shoter. He was always strong...punched hard and pretty relentless when he wanted to be before. With the new style....he ends up frustrating himself because he misses so much.

    Tbf a good overall performance....and roys done decent enough with him...but you just cant really make eubank junior a great boxer. We,re on the right path making him strong and throwing a lot of punches. Just came up against 2 guys with good footwork in billy joe and groves.

    Groves and billy joe would beat this version of eubank better imo.
